The Confederation is convinced that empowerment of visually impaired women and strengthening the existing grass-root organizations/associations must receive the highest priority, if we have to reach out to the largest number of our blind population.
AICB, in respect of visually impaired women :
- Has constituted a National Forum of Blind Women, one of the very few groupings of its kind in the country.
- Runs a special hostel at its premises in Delhi for college-going girl students, providing them boarding, lodging and reading material free of charge.
- Offers Merit Scholarships of substantial amount to blind women students for pursuing professional and career-oriented courses of study.
- Conducts a number of leadership training and personality-development programmes & Convened through its Women's Forum four National and International Conferences of blind women in New Delhi.
- Takes special care to include blind women in all its training and rehabilitation programmes.
- The Confederation also strives continuously to provide trained leadership and improved facilities for its Affiliates and other organizations of the blind nationally and internationally.
It has :
- Convened a number of seminars for providing training in leadership to representatives from state and local organizations/associations.
- Conducted training courses in Office Management to update the skills of employees/office bearers of associations of the blind from India as also from countries like Bangladesh, Nepal, Sri Lanka, Pakistan, Indonesia and Uganda. Brought out a Manual in Office Management in English and Hindi, Helped its Affiliates secure assistance from funding agencies for various projects.
